Arthur Davies and his partner June Nicolopolous received the item at their home address at Lacon Road, East Dulwich, on Thursday lunchtime.
It was addressed to a Mr & Mrs Richardson, date-marked 1929 and posted from Burnham-on-Crouch, Essex.

"My initial thought was that it was a hoax," said Mr Davies. "But when I looked at the envelope it was in, I noticed it was Royal Mail and it said that this item had been delayed in the post.
"You expect sometimes letters to be a couple of days late but 79 years is taking the mickey a bit."
A Royal Mail spokesman said: "It is impossible to determine exactly what has happened to this item of mail."
